Assurance Wireless offers complimentary wireless services funded by the Universal Service Fund, making it accessible to those in need across the country. This program, operated under Virgin Mobile, aims to connect underserved areas. However, qualifying for a new device and service involves specific steps and eligibility criteria.
To successfully obtain a new Assurance Wireless connection, follow these tips:
Verify Service Coverage in Your Location – While Assurance Wireless services are nationwide, eligibility and offers vary by state. Confirm whether your area qualifies by entering your ZIP code on their official site.
Assess Eligibility Requirements – To qualify for Assurance Wireless, you must provide valid proof of address and income. Participants in programs like SNAP or Medicaid automatically qualify. Household income criteria also apply, with restrictions on multiple lines per household.
Select an appropriate device – All Assurance Wireless phones operate on Android and come with features supporting fast data, calls, and text messaging. Choose a handset that best suits your needs and comfort.
Maintain Your Service – Keep your service active by renewing your plan on time. Whether your residence is permanent or temporary, staying compliant ensures uninterrupted benefits. Attractive plans are available to both new and existing customers.
